Absolutely! 'a thousand ships' dives deep into Greek mythology, but with a twist—it gives voice to the women often sidelined in those ancient tales. Natalie Haynes reimagines the Trojan War through their eyes, from Penelope’s lonely vigil to Cassandra’s cursed prophecies. The book stitches together myths, fragments, and forgotten heroines, making it feel like a tapestry of grief, love, and resilience.

What’s brilliant is how Haynes blends familiar stories—Helen’s flight, the fall of Troy—with lesser-known figures like the Amazon Penthesilea or the nymph Oenone. The prose is lyrical but sharp, turning gods and mortals alike into flawed, vivid characters. It’s not just a retelling; it’s a reclaiming, showing how mythology’s echoes still shape our understanding of war and womanhood today.

For mythology buffs, 'a thousand ships' is a treasure trove. It’s rooted in Greek myths but flips the script, focusing on the women behind the war’s grand narratives. Think of it as a chorus of voices—queens, goddesses, even a muse narrating their own sagas. Haynes doesn’t just recycle Homer; she expands it, weaving in Ovid’s heroines and Euripides’ tragedies. The result feels both ancient and fresh, like uncovering a new layer to stories you thought you knew.

How Does 'A Thousand Ships' Portray Helen Of Troy?

4 คำตอบ2025-06-28 06:33:09
In 'A Thousand Ships', Helen of Troy is far from the passive beauty often depicted in myths. She’s a complex figure, both blamed and pitied, her agency overshadowed by the men who fight for her. The book peels back layers of her myth, showing her as a woman trapped by fate, yet sharp enough to manipulate it. Her chapters simmer with quiet defiance—she knows the war isn’t truly about her, but she’s branded its catalyst anyway. The narrative gives her a voice that’s weary but not broken, dissecting the irony of being called 'the face that launched a thousand ships' while having no control over those ships. Her portrayal is a masterclass in reclaiming a misunderstood icon, blending historical weight with modern feminist undertones. What’s striking is how the author avoids vilifying or glorifying her. Helen’s guilt is ambiguous; she regrets the bloodshed but never apologizes for wanting more than her gilded cage. The prose lingers on her isolation—queen yet prisoner, desired yet despised. It’s a fresh take that makes her more than a plot device, framing her as a survivor navigating a world that reduces her to a symbol.

Who Are The Main Female Characters In 'A Thousand Ships'?

4 คำตอบ2025-06-28 10:24:55
'A Thousand Ships' by Natalie Haynes reimagines the Trojan War through the eyes of its women, giving voice to those often silenced by myth. The main female characters include Helen, whose beauty sparked the war but whose agency is dissected beyond her reputation as a mere prize. Hecuba, the fallen queen of Troy, embodies grief and resilience, her rage sharp as a blade after losing her children and city. Then there’s Penelope, Odysseus’ wife, whose letters to her absent husband reveal her wit and weariness, a woman weaving patience into strategy. Andromache, Hector’s widow, portrays the brutal cost of war, her sorrow tempered by quiet defiance. Briseis, once a princess turned slave, offers a raw perspective on survival and loss. Lesser-known figures like the prophetess Cassandra and the Amazon Penthesilea add depth—Cassandra’s cursed foresight haunting her, Penthesilea’s warrior spirit blazing briefly but brilliantly. Haynes’ genius lies in how she stitches these voices into a tapestry that’s as epic as it is intimate, showing war not through heroes’ swords but through the women who endured its echoes.

How Does 'A Thousand Ships' Retell The Trojan War?

4 คำตอบ2025-06-28 16:07:54
'A Thousand Ships' by Natalie Haynes flips the Trojan War narrative by spotlighting the women whose voices were drowned in Homer's epics. It's a mosaic of perspectives—queens like Hecabe and Clytemnestra reveal the cost of war beyond the battlefield, where grief and resilience intertwine. Penelope’s sarcastic letters to Odysseus mock his delayed return, while lesser-known figures like the Trojan priestess Briseis recount their enslavement with raw humanity. The chorus of Muses adds a lyrical layer, framing the war as a tapestry of suffering rather than heroism. Haynes doesn’t just retell; she reimagines. The novel stitches together fragmented myths into a cohesive critique of glory, emphasizing the collateral damage on women. Even the titular ships become symbols of forced journeys—abduction, exile, survival. By centering emotional truth over action, the book transforms ancient war into a timeless meditation on voice and memory.

How Many Ships Did Odysseus Have

5 คำตอบ2025-08-01 08:55:59
As someone who's deeply immersed in ancient epics, I've always been fascinated by the details in Homer's 'Odyssey'. Odysseus initially set sail from Troy with a fleet of twelve ships, each carrying his loyal Ithacan warriors. This number is significant because it reflects the unity of his homeland—twelve ships for the twelve main regions of Ithaca. Over the course of his journey, his fleet faced relentless trials, from the Cicones' retaliation to the monstrous Laestrygonians, who destroyed all but one ship. By the time Odysseus reached the island of the Cyclops, only his own vessel remained, a stark symbol of his isolation and resilience. Later, after surviving Scylla and Charybdis, even that final ship was lost due to his crew's defiance (they ate the sacred cattle of Helios). The gradual reduction of his fleet mirrors the themes of hubris and divine punishment in the epic. It's a haunting reminder of how quickly fortune can turn in Greek mythology.
